Output f7da81dcc75d59bfd4e76e9d44cbba89be2b09561a0c688d3da35d171e54bfe7:1

value
29086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237ab84e40cee7cc25aff1ea59d3697d88ede67e OP_EQUAL
address
34vcazKJH5st9wJX1oUfCfFhrCoJx7N9H1
transaction
f7da81dcc75d59bfd4e76e9d44cbba89be2b09561a0c688d3da35d171e54bfe7
confirmations
270345
spent
true